. After her Phd she went into teaching whilst living in the UK and Germany. She joined Cardiff University in 1984. Her 1987 book ''Feminist Practice & Poststructuralist Theory'' has been translated into German and Korean. In 2010 she announced £4m funding for a project on multiculturalism at Cardiff University. The project would fund four PhD students, and the research would look at the challenges to culture for both white and black citizens. Weedon considered that there were particular complexities for those living in Wales. Weedon was the chair of the Butetown History & Arts Centre.
